#4feb33 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4feb33 is composed of 31% red, 92.2% green and 20%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 66.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 78.3% yellow and 7.8% black. It has a hue angle of 110.9 degrees, a saturation of 82.1% and a lightness of 56.1%. #4feb33 color hex could be obtained by blending #9eff66 with #00d700. Closest websafe color is: #66ff33.

#4feb33 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4feb33 has RGB values of R:79, G:235, B:51 and CMYK values of C:0.66, M:0, Y:0.78, K:0.08. Its decimal value is 5237555.

Shades and Tints of #4feb33
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020a01 is the darkest color, while #f9fef8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#4feb33
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8b9589 is the less saturated color, while #43fc22 is the most saturated one.
